Understanding Breast Augmentation
What is Breast Augmentation?
Breast augmentation, also known as augmentation mammoplasty, is a surgical procedure designed to enhance the size, shape, and symmetry of the breasts. This is typically achieved through the placement of breast implants, which can be made of saline, silicone, or a patient's own fat (fat transfer). According to Big Apple Bust, some people choose breast augmentation to achieve a more proportionate figure, while others may want to replace lost breast volume due to aging, pregnancy, or weight loss. The procedure can also correct asymmetrical breasts.
Types of Breast Implants
- Saline Implants: These implants are made of a silicone shell filled with sterile salt water. They typically require smaller incisions than silicone implants and are approved for women over 18. Rockmore Plastic Surgery notes that in the hands of a qualified plastic surgeon, saline implants can create excellent results.
- Silicone Implants: Silicone implants have a durable silicone shell filled with a gel of varying cohesiveness. The most cohesive implants are often called “gummy bear” breast implants. They are approved for women over 22 and are popular for their natural look and feel.
- Fat Transfer: Fat transfer involves removing fat from other parts of the body, such as the abdomen or thighs, and injecting it into the breasts. This method uses the patient's own body fat, reducing the risk of rejection and offering more natural results. However, it typically achieves a smaller increase in size compared to other implant types.

The Breast Augmentation Procedure
Pre - operative Consultation
Before the surgery, you will have a consultation with your chosen surgeon. During this consultation, the surgeon will assess your suitability for the procedure, discuss your goals and expectations, and perform a physical examination. You will also have the opportunity to discuss implant options, incision locations, and implant placement. Deluca Plastic Surgery uses a scientifically - designed, mentor breast implant sizing system and 3 - D computer simulations to help patients visualize their results.
The Surgery
Breast augmentation surgery typically lasts between one and two hours and is an outpatient procedure. The surgeon will first administer anesthesia and then make an incision in a pre - determined location, such as the inframammary fold, periareolar area, or axilla. A pocket is created for the implant, which is then inserted. The incisions are then closed with sutures, and the breasts are supported with a post - operative bra. The specific surgical technique will depend on factors such as the type of implant and the patient's anatomy.
Recovery and Aftercare
Recovery after breast augmentation involves following your surgeon's post - operative instructions carefully. You can expect some discomfort, swelling, and bruising in the initial days after surgery. Most patients can shower the day after surgery (with caution), resume driving within a few days, and return to work and light activities within a week. Strenuous activities should be avoided for several weeks. Rockmore Plastic Surgery provides patients with a comfortable surgical bra to wear continuously for the first couple of weeks to support the breasts and minimize swelling. Follow - up appointments are scheduled to monitor your healing and ensure there are no complications.
